An experienced therapist offers groundbreaking techniques for helping `chronically inflexible` children, who suffer from excessively immoderate tempers, showing how brain-based deficits contribute to these problems and offering positive and constructive ways to calm things down. Tour. Amazon.com description: Product Description: Dr. Ross Greene provides a compassionate, practical approach to treating explosive" children. Rather than viewing their behavior as willfully disobedient, he draws upon recent advances in the neurosciences and his extensive experience working with challenging children at Massachusetts General Hospital/Harvard Medical School in explaining that the difficulties of these children stem from brain-based deficits in two critical developmental skills: flexibility and frustration tolerance. These children may suffer from oppositional defiant disorder (ODD) and bipolar disorder. Often misdiagnosed under the broad umbrella of attention de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), they are too readily treated with drugs that can exacerbate their behavior. In a departure from treatments relying on rewarding and punishing, Dr. Greene`s approach helps us grasp the underlying problems of explosive children, defuse explosive episodes, and reduce tension and hostility levels for the entire family by providing valuable tools for coping"

We've all seen them: children who explode when they're told to do something or when things don't go their way. The ones who completely lose control and become verbally and physically aggressive. Spoiled, stubborn, manipulative children. Right?

Not so fast. These labels suggest that the behavior if such children is planned and intentional, and popular reward-and-punishment strategies are typically used to teach and motivate them to behave more appropriately. But for a significant number of these children, the standard approach doesn't always work. Such children are easily frustrated and extremely inflexible. They get "stuck" over seemingly simple requests, benign issues, and sudden changes in plans. They may be very anxious, irritable, and volatile. They may have difficulty telling you what they're frustrated about or thinking through potential solutions to problems. In clinical terms, they may be diagnosed with any of a variety of psychiatric disorders, including oppositional-defiant disorder, att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), Tourette's disorder, depression, and bipolar disorder. If this sounds like your child, you're probably feeling frustrated, overwhelmed, guilt-ridden, exhausted, and hopeless.

Now there is a new way for you, your child, and your entire family to find help. In this groundbreaking new book, Dr. Ross Greene, a child psychologist at Massachusetts General Hospital and Harvard Medical School, makes a compassionate argument that the difficulties of these children stem from developmental deficits in two critical skills: flexibility and frustration tolerance. He asserts that if such children could do well, they would.

Drawing upon recent advances in the neuroscience, Dr. Greene describes the factor that contribute to "inflexible-explosive" behavior in children and why the strategies that work for most children aren't as effective for inflexible-explosive children. Then, with the help of "snapshots" from the lives of children, parents, and teachers with whom he has worked over the years, Dr. Greene lays out a sensitive, practical, effective, systematic approach to helping these children at home and school, including:

  • reducing hostility and antagonism between the child and adult

  • anticipating situations in which the child is most likely to explode

  • creating an environment in which explosions are less likely to occur

  • focusing less on reward and punishment and more on communication and collaborative problem-solving

  • helping the child develop the self-regulation and thinking skills to be more flexible and handle frustration more adaptively
